Can a solar rechargeable lantern be charged indoors?

First off, let's understand how solar rechargeable lanterns work. These nifty little devices come equipped with solar panels that soak up sunlight and convert it into electricity. This electricity is then stored in a battery, which powers the lantern when it's dark. It's a pretty cool and eco - friendly concept, right?

Now, back to the main question. The short answer is yes, a solar rechargeable lantern can be charged indoors, but it's not as straightforward as charging it outdoors under direct sunlight.

Charging Indoors: The Basics

When you're indoors, the main source of light is usually artificial light, like the bulbs in your ceiling or table lamps. Solar panels are designed to absorb light and convert it into energy. Artificial light, such as from incandescent, fluorescent, or LED bulbs, can also be absorbed by the solar panels, but there are some catches.

The intensity of indoor light is much lower compared to sunlight. Sunlight is incredibly powerful, and solar panels are optimized to work best under its rays. For instance, on a bright sunny day, sunlight can have an intensity of around 1000 watts per square meter. In contrast, the light from a typical indoor LED bulb might only have an intensity of a few watts per square meter.

This means that charging a solar rechargeable lantern indoors will take a lot longer. If it takes, say, 6 - 8 hours to fully charge the lantern under direct sunlight, it could take anywhere from 24 to 48 hours or even more indoors. You'll also need to place the lantern very close to the light source to maximize the amount of light the solar panel can absorb.

Types of Indoor Light and Their Effectiveness

Let's talk a bit more about different types of indoor light. Incandescent bulbs produce light by heating a filament until it glows. They emit a broad spectrum of light, which includes some wavelengths that solar panels can use. However, they're not very energy - efficient, and a lot of the energy they consume is wasted as heat.

Fluorescent bulbs work by passing an electric current through a gas, which then emits ultraviolet light. This ultraviolet light is converted into visible light by a phosphor coating on the inside of the bulb. Fluorescent lights are more energy - efficient than incandescent bulbs, and they can also be used to charge solar rechargeable lanterns. But again, their light intensity is relatively low.

LED bulbs are the most energy - efficient option. They produce light by passing an electric current through a semiconductor. LED lights come in different color temperatures, and some are better suited for charging solar panels than others. Generally, daylight - colored LEDs (with a color temperature of around 5000 - 6500K) are a good choice because they have a spectrum that's closer to sunlight.

Other Indoor Charging Options

Apart from using indoor light, many solar rechargeable lanterns also come with alternative charging methods. Most models have a USB port, which means you can charge them using a power bank, a laptop, or a wall charger. This is a much faster and more reliable way to charge the lantern indoors.

If you're in a hurry and need to use the lantern right away, plugging it into a power source via USB is the way to go. It can cut down the charging time significantly, sometimes getting the lantern fully charged in just a couple of hours.

Benefits of Indoor Charging

While indoor charging might be slower, it does have its advantages. For one, it's convenient. You don't have to wait for a sunny day to charge your lantern. If you're in a place where the weather is unpredictable or if you need to charge the lantern in a hurry, indoor charging gives you that flexibility.

It also allows you to keep an eye on the charging process. You can make sure the lantern is placed in the right position and that it's not being knocked over or damaged.
